我以前是学C++的,现在想转型学C#~虽然语法差不多,但是概念什么的都不太一样,学的有点吃力。各位大虾能给我指一条明路么~比如怎么学,看什么书,做什么项目之类的  ~~~现在对C#还没有个明确的概念~~~

解决方案 »

  1.   

    从c++到c#还会吃力? c++的语法大部分都用的上,概念在一定程度上都是一样的, 编程方面又像vb那样方便, 你先找本基础的书看看,不行就先照着敲代码,熟练了自然就理解了,理解后学习是非常快的。
      

  2.   

    推荐《C#高级编程》里面对比讲解了C#与C++的不同之处。
      

  3.   

    我是从C#转到C++,现在都搞,感觉真的差不多,C#要简单的很多很多很多很多。。
      

  4.   

    学了C++再做C#对很多基础的东西了解得很清楚的,但是就像楼主说的还是有很多的差别。
    基础的语法和控件的属性等我感觉是最初需要掌握的东西。
    建议楼主先把控件先用用熟,然后自己做一些控件和类。然后你要确定你做C#, 是做哪一块呢?winform还是WEB上的开发?
    做哪一块就往哪一块走。
      

  5.   

    C++转什么C#
    承认自己智商不够,搞不了C++?
      

  6.   

    学过JAVA吗?我觉得学过C++和JAVA,接受C#会非常顺利一些,其实内部东西跟C++差不多,外部结构和JAVA一样,我个人这么觉得,我也是新学的C#
      

  7.   

    I think you should learn C++ more harder. if you have deeply understood operator/template... in C++.then C# just is a subset of C++.
      

  8.   

    有个C# primier这本书,挺好的
      

  9.   

    你别吓我,说你学得慢是不可能的,我现在用很多类都是要调用C++的库,我想看都看不懂类,交个朋友互相学习咯C#一行代码,可能C++要写10行不止,很容易的。只是C++得过程编程习惯,转面向对象,接口编程,一时会变不过来而已
      

  10.   

    回的人太多了我就不一个一个回了~~~分就给SF了  ~~~学了一阶段C++,感觉很烦~~虽然c++是一款很强大的语言~~~不是智商不够~~~是想做点东西出来了~~~不然学了这么长时间~~~~          
    C#做开发比较快,简单很多~~~学学总没有坏处~   额
    对模板和类的理解,我想我应该理解的比较充分了吧 ~~~  然后就一直在看MFC和ATL~~~我看看看  ~~~还得努力学   ~~~~